Abhishek Bajaj will soon be seen as a contestant in Salman Khan hosted reality show Bigg Boss 19. He is best known for Babli Bouncer, Student Of The Year 2 and others.
In an exclusive interview with Bollywood Bubble, Abhishek is ready to do every task besides cooking and admitted he doesn’t know how to cook. The actor revealed whether he will be making friends on the show. Scroll down to read more.
Abhishek Bajaj Admits He Doesn’t Know How To Cook
When asked about the tough challenges during Bigg Boss 19, like cleaning the washroom and fighting over food, Abhishek Bajaj revealed, “Baaki sab kar lenge. Khana banana woh mujhe nahi aata hai. Mujhe lagta hai wahan seekhna padega. Aur mujhe logon ko manana aata hai ki khana bana le. But haan yaar, woh toh ho sakta hai. Baaki toh dekha jaayega, woh bhi kar lenge, kya dikkat hai? Acting kaunsi aati thi pehle… chalo seekh li, kar li. Bachpan se thoda seekha tha.”
Abhishek Bajaj On Making Friends In Bigg Boss 19
Talking about Bigg Boss friendships, Abhishek said, “Dosti wala dost hoon main, matlab main hamesha yaarian hi nibhata aaya hoon. Aur hamesha se mere dost aate rahe hain. Jinhe main dost maanta hoon, main unko sach mein dost maanta hoon. Matlab, main chahta hoon ki woh bhi grow karein saath. So I’m that kind of person. Abhi dekho, but kehte hain na ki bharosa bhi wahi todte hain jo bharosa karte hain. I think, logon ko Bigg Boss ke baad nikal ke woh cheezein chhod deni chahiye, Bigg Boss tak hi rehni chahiye. Because it’s a game. Everybody wants to win the game, everybody wants to be seen, everybody wants to make an impression, and they want to give their best. So they do things. I think it’s a game, and people should leave that over there.”
